Fans Choose j-hope Feat. Miguel’s ‘Sweet Dreams’ as This Week’s Favorite New Music

j–hope feat. Miguel‘s “Sweet Dreams” tops this week’s new music poll.

Music fans voted in a poll published Friday (March 7) on Billboard, choosing the BTS star’s fresh song with an R&B veteran as their favorite new music release of the past week.

There was tough competition in this week’s poll, but the latest from j-hope managed to bring in 77% of the vote. Voters this week chose “Sweet Dreams” over new music releases from talent across genres — with artists in the mix including JENNIE, Lady Gaga, Doechii, Dolly Parton and more.

The single, which just dropped on March 7, is a top pick by Billboard readers just in time for j-hope’s solo debut on The Tonight Show Starring Jimmy Fallon on Monday, March 10, where he’ll take the stage to perform “Sweet Dreams.”

It also arrives in the midst of his Hope on the Stage Tour, which kicked off in Seoul at the end of February and makes its way to Brooklyn later this week. Dates in Chicago, Mexico City, San Antonio, Oakland and Los Angeles follow, and then j-hope will bring the show to Asia.

j-hope, producer Johnny Goldstein and songwriters Sam Martin, Sean Douglas and Theron Makiel Thomas have credits on the track.

Among the new music trailing behind “Sweet Dreams” on the poll this week are two albums that have been highly anticipated: JENNIE’s Ruby, with 12% of the vote, and Lady Gaga’s Mayhem, with 7% of the vote.
